Output d425f417eb2fb34cc86cc6568e5649ec1293eb00260e23c3e813e3768622f4bb:20

value
16640185
script pubkey
OP_0 OP_PUSHBYTES_20 69a3e97b123ae01a33af0d839bdefeb43d3bbc66
address
bc1qdx37j7cj8tsp5va0pkpehhh7ks7nh0rxhkzdu7
transaction
d425f417eb2fb34cc86cc6568e5649ec1293eb00260e23c3e813e3768622f4bb
confirmations
160218
spent
true